ElevateBio Collaborates with AWS to Broaden the Potential of CRISPR Gene Editing Therapies with Generative AI
- ElevateBio will leverage artificial intelligence to expand and accelerate CRISPR discovery, design, and drug development for thousands of complex monogenic and polygenic diseases
- Generative AI combined with ElevateBio Life Edit’s immense library of CRISPR systems and proprietary data from experiments will drive the synthesis and optimization of novel CRISPR drugs for genetic diseases
WALTHAM, Mass., March 10, 2025 (GLOBE NEWSWIRE) -- ElevateBio, a technology-driven company focused on powering the creation of life-transforming genetic medicines, announced a multi-year collaboration with Amazon Web Services (AWS) to accelerate the discovery and development of CRISPR gene editing therapeutics through generative artificial intelligence (AI). ElevateBio aims to broaden the range of diseases addressable by gene editing therapies by combining the gene editing technologies and large CRISPR dataset of ElevateBio Life Edit – the Company’s gene editing and R&D technology business – with AWS’s advanced computing capabilities.
Under the collaboration, Life Edit will leverage AWS’s cloud infrastructure and SageMaker, which integrates machine learning and analytics, to train and execute its state-of-the-art protein language models (PLMs) at scale. This will enable Life Edit to rapidly analyze and interpret vast amounts of protein and proprietary experimental data to identify, design, and optimize new CRISPR systems more efficiently than traditional methods.

CRISPR gene editing enables precise modifications to DNA, offering new possibilities for treating genetic disorders. The Life Edit gene editing platform is available to make a broad spectrum of edits – including base editing and reverse transcriptase editing – for the development of ex vivo and in vivo therapies. This collaboration will expand efforts to optimize and generate custom CRISPR therapies for genetic disease, both for partners and for internal pipeline development, with a focus on two key areas:
-
CRISPR discovery and design: Life Edit is analyzing its immense library of CRISPR systems, one of the largest in the industry, as well as data generated through experiments, to accelerate the discovery and design of both naturally occurring and synthetic custom CRISPR systems. Through a proof-of-concept project that leveraged AWS’s infrastructure – including GPUs (graphics processing units) on Amazon EC2, Amazon S3, and Amazon SageMaker AI Studio – to share and power PLM evaluations with reduced complexity, Life Edit has already demonstrated an expansion of its protein discovery capabilities while significantly decreasing costs.
- Target optimization: Using a combination of PLM-driven active learning and Life Edit’s screens for DNA binding, nuclease activity, base editing, reverse transcriptase editing, and off-target activity, Life Edit is performing targeted protein optimization to design the best CRISPR proteins and improve their therapeutic potential.
